Talk Python to Me is a weekly podcast hosted by developer and entrepreneur Michael Kennedy. We dive deep into the popular packages and software developers, data scientists, and incredible hobbyists doing amazing things with Python. If you're new to Python, you'll quickly learn the ins and outs of the community by hearing from the leaders. And if you've been Pythoning for years, you'll learn about your favorite packages and the hot new ones coming out of open source.

#387: Build All the Things with Pants Build System

October 27, 2022 01:07:50 57.26 MB Downloads: 0
Do you have a large or growing Python code base? If you struggle to run builds, tests, linting, and other quality checks regularly or quickly, you'll want to hear what Benjy Weinberger has to say. He's here to introduce Pants Build to us. Pants is a fast, scalable, user-friendly build system for codebases of all sizes. It's currently focused on Python, Go, Java, Scala, Kotlin, Shell, and Docker.

Links from the show

Benjy on Twitter: @benjy
Pants Build: pantsbuild.org
Pants Source: github.com
Getting help in the Pants community: pantsbuild.org/docs/getting-help
An example repo to demonstrate Python support in Pants: github.com
Toolchain: toolchain.com
Watch this episode on YouTube: youtube.com
Episode transcripts: talkpython.fm

--- Stay in touch with us ---
Subscribe to us on YouTube: youtube.com
Follow Talk Python on Twitter: @talkpython
Follow Michael on Twitter: @mkennedy

Sponsors
Local Maximum Podcast
Microsoft
AssemblyAI
Talk Python Training